Share to Twitter Share to Linkedin For 72 minutes of Sunday’s FA Cup quarter-final against Fulham, Manchester United were in trouble. The visitors to Old Trafford were 1-0 up and in control until a double red card for Aleksandar Mitrovic and Willian completely changed the dynamic of the contest. With a two-man advantage, United ultimately ran out 3-1 winners. Nonetheless, Erik Ten Hag must heed the warnings provided by the majority of his team’s performance. Despite their talent advantage and the advantage of being the home side, Manchester United were second best and the Dutch manager must ensure there is no knock-on effect after the international break. Many pointed to Casemiro’s absence as reason for United’s underwhelming display. Indeed, the Brazilian, who was serving the first match of a four-match suspension, was a miss with his presence and defensive instincts lacking in the centre of the pitch. Born to play football – Pelé passes in Sao Paulo hospital, aged 82

December 30, 2022 by thethaiger.com

“I was born to play football, just like Beethoven was born to write music and Michelangelo was born to paint.” Pelé, born Edson Arantes do Nascimento on October 23, 1940, in Três Corações , a small town in Minas Gerais, Brazil, has died at Albert Einstein hospital in São Paulo after a long illness, at the age of 82. Pelé, the Brazilian virtuoso whose skill and athleticism saw him universally regarded as one of the world’s greatest-ever footballers had a colon tumour removed in 2021, and was readmitted to Albert Einstein hospital in São Paulo in November amid deteriorating health. A hospital statement on Thursday confirmed the death of “our dear King of Football” at 3.27pm local time, “due to the failure of multiple organs, a result of the progression of cancer of colon associated with his previous clinical condition.” Known as “The King” (O Rei) in Brazil, Pelé scored 12 goals in 14 World Cup final games. Amtrak’s new cheap fares to New York City and D.C. are as low as $5, but there’s a catch

March 20, 2023 by www.fastcompany.com

Amtrak is hoping to get more people to ride its rails by offering a new type of fare that sees one-way tickets costing as little as $5. These cheap tickets will get you to or from popular destinations including New York, Washington, D.C., Baltimore, Newark, and Philadelphia. But there’s a catch. Amtrak’s ultra-low fares are part of its new Night Owl offerings . As the name implies, the fares are for select journeys during the evening and very early morning hours, specifically between the hours of 7 p.m. and 5 a.m. These Night Owl fares are also only being offered on select Amtrak Northeast Corridor (NEC) routes.
